Grosvenor Hotel, 1912. Built by the Victorian railway pioneers in 1862, The Grosvenor Hotel Victoria ushered in a Golden Age of travel.and is a Grade II listed building. From The Connoisseur Vol XXXII. [ Otto Limited, London, 1912]
